Compounds | 1 | 2 |
---|---|---|
Chemical Formula | C20H16Cl2Cu2N4S4 | C22H20Cl2Cu2N4S4 |
Formula weight | 638.59 | 666.64 |
Crystal system | Monoclinic | Triclinic |
Space group | P21/n | Pi |
a [Å] | 7.33 (4) | 7.42 (5) |
b [Å] | 19.29 (1) | 9.35 (7) |
c [Å] | 8.80 (5) | 10.85 (8) |
α[°] | 90.00 | 104.91 (6) |
β[°] | 109.94 (4) | 101.32 (6) |
γ [°] | 90.00 | 111.75 (5) |
V [Å3] | 1171.25 (11) | 639.06 (8) |
Z | 2 | 1 |
Crystal size [mm] | 0.38 × 0.23 × 0.16 | 0.15 × 0.13 × 0.12 |
D [g cm−3] | 1.811 | 1.732 |
U [mm−1](Mo-Kα) Å | 0.71073 | 0.71073 |
Temperature [K] | 133 | 133 |
θ range [°] | 2.1–27.7 | 2.1–26.7 |
Unique reflections | 19,359 | 2709 |
Reflections observed | 2744 | 9485 |
Parameters | 145 | 155 |
R[F2 > 2σ(F2)] | 0.036 | 0.035 |
wR(F2) | 0.095 | 0.082 |
